Davis, WV—Canaan Valley Resort has joined with 35 independent ski resorts to offer a multi-resort ski pass called the Indy Pass. On sale today for the 2019-2020 season, the Indy Pass will provide two days of access - 68 total days - at 36 independently owned resorts for just $199.

Indy Pass resorts provide an uncrowded and welcoming experience for individuals and families seeking great snow and varied terrain. In addition, vacation getaways at these quaint ski areas cost a small fraction of what major resorts charge for comparable stays.

Canaan Resort season pass holders will have to option to purchase a Season Pass Indy Add On for just $159. The Indy Add On will be valid at all Indy Pass resorts except Canaan Resort and is available now for purchase until October 31, 2019.

The Indy Pass is a response by independent ski areas to the consolidation of many high-profile resorts that sell multi-mountain ski passes and command vast marketing resources. This has left independent and family-owned areas at a big disadvantage. Indy Pass resorts will be part of a marketing co-op dedicated to promoting the benefits of small-to-mid-sized areas.

“Independent resorts are the heart and soul of North American skiing and anything that provides more access and exposure to these hidden gems is something we’ll support.” said Ken Rider, GM at Brundage Mountain Resort, Idaho.

28 of 36 participating resorts offer UNRESTRICTED, season-long access. Four have holiday blackouts and two allow midweek-only access. See indyskipass.com for details and a list of all participating resorts.
